Citations Affected: IC 25-21.5.
Synopsis: Land surveyors. Allows a licensed land surveyor to enter
any land or property within Indiana to conduct a survey. Provides
procedures for notifying a landowner and makes a surveyor liable for
damage caused by the entry.
Effective: July 1, 2010.

(b) A land surveyor shall present written identification to the occupant of the land or water to be entered under section 7 of this
chapter before entering the land or water.
(c) A land surveyor shall be liable for any damage that may
occur to the land or property as a result of entry upon, over, or
under the land or property under section 7 of this chapter.
